Orientalist Lives: Western Artists in the Middle East, 1830–1920 Alessandro; Guidebooks; The ultimate guide to The Egyptian Museum of Cairo.; TRAVEL / Middle East / Egypt" Set in Cairo during Worldby James Parry In one of the most remarkable artistic pilgrimages in history, the nineteenth century saw scores of Western artists heading to the Middle East. Inspired by the allure of the exotic Orient, they went in search of subjects for their paintings.
